Jordan Breen returned to the Sherdog Radio Network on Thursday, and was joined by Dream featherweight GP entrant Joe Warren and hot welterweight prospect Tyron Woodley.

Warren discusses his transition from wrestling to MMA, which will see him take on Japanese superstar Norifumi "Kid" Yamamoto in the Dream GP quarterfinals. The 2006 Greco-Roman wrestling world champion discusses his travels in the Eastern Bloc, training with Urijah Faber, and his own personal struggles that led to a two-year suspension from wrestling from the U.S. Anti-Doping Agency.

Woodley talks about his upcoming bout on Strikeforce's June 6 bill against Sal Woods, in front of his home St. Louis crowd. The two-time All-American from Mizzou tells why St. Louis is a real fighting city, his recent training at American Kickboxing Academy, and his distaste for both Tapout t-shirt wearers and "Tobasco."

Breen also talks about the non-UFC action from the weekend ahead, including cards Shooto, ZST, Australia's CFC and China's Art of War.
